C. PUBLIC HEARINGS
C.1. SUP 2018-03 PUBLIC HEARING AND CONSIDERATION OF A REQUEST
FROM BOB E. GRIGGS FOR A SPECIAL USE PERMIT FOR A METAL
ACCESSORY STRUCTURE AT 7229 LONDONDERRY DRIVE, BEING
3.676 ACRES DESCRIBED AS LOT 2R1, BLOCK 1, DOUBLE K RANCH
ADDITION.
APPROVED
Chairman Justin Welborn introduced the item and called for Principal Clayton
Husband to introduce the request. Mr. Husband introduced the request.
Chairman Welborn called for the applicant to present the request.
Larry Cunningham, 6213 Riviera Drive, North Richland Hills, Texas 76180, presented
the request on behalf of Bob E. Griggs.
Commissioner Jerry Tyner asked Mr. Cunningham what the height of the structure is.
Mr. Husband stated he could go over the dimensions of the building during the
presentation of the staff report.
Commissioner Mason Orr and Mr. Cunningham discussed why the structure is

requesting a variance to the masonry requirement for permanent accessory
structures.
Chairman Justin Welborn and Mr. Cunningham discussed the ages of the existing
structures on the property.
Chairman Welborn and Mr. Cunningham discussed the concrete apron for the
proposed structure.
Commissioner Don Bowen and Mr. Cunningham discussed the option of adding a
wainscoting to the structure and to consider adding landscaping on the west side.
Chairman Welborn called for Mr. Husband to present the staff report. Mr. Husband
presented the staff report and mentioned the building height is slightly under 16 feet.
Commissioner Bowen and Mr. Husband discussed the addition of wainscoting to the
proposed structure and what was approved in similar requests.
Commissioner Bowen asked if the location can be a part of the motion. Mr. Husband
stated yes.
Chairman Welborn confirmed with Mr. Husband that the structure could be built with
a building permit subject to meeting masonry and roof pitch requirements. Chairman
Welborn asked what the maximum size and height limits for the accessory building
apply to the property. Mr. Husband stated the maximum size is 4,000 square feet and
maximum height is 25 feet.
Chairman Welborn called for anyone wishing to speak.
Debbie Herrera, 7300 Wexford Court, North Richland Hills, Texas, 76182, spoke in
opposition due to proposed location, masonry requirement, and asked about
drainage.
Chairman Welborn asked if Ms. Herrera could see the building. Ms. Herrera stated
yes.
David Herrera, 7300 Wexford Court, North Richland Hills ,Texas, 76182, spoke in
opposition of the request concerning masonry and location.
Johnny Lopez, 7228 Bursey Road, North Richland Hills, Texas 76182, spoke in

opposition of the request concerning the proposed location and masonry
requirement.
Marc Trevino, 7300 Bursey Road, North Richland Hills, Texas 76180, spoke in
support of the request.
Lydia Lopez, 7228 Bursey Road, North Richland Hills, Texas 76180, spoke in
opposition over potential drainage issues.
Chairman Welborn asked for Civil Engineer Justin Naylor to explain what is required
by public works during the permitting process for this type of accessory structure.
Mr. Naylor and Mr. Husband discussed the requirements.
Chairman Welborn asked for anyone wishing to speak for or against the request to
come forward. There being no one wishing to speak, Chairman Welborn closed the
public hearing.
Commissioner Mason Orr provided his position for the request.
Chairman Welborn provided his position and stated the setback from the north should
be increased to 20 feet from 10 feet, and that landscaping should be added to soften
the appearance of the structure. Commissioner Bowen stated due to the anticipated
sale of the northern portion of the property and the expected addition of a new
stockade fence, he feels some of the view will be diminished. Mr. Welborn stated the
most affected citizens will likely be to the east.
Commissioner Kathy Luppy and Commissioner Jerry Tyner stated their support for
wainscoting around the structure.
Mr. Husband stated the there is a distance of about 140 feet to 150 feet between the
proposed structure and Wexford Court.
A MOTION WAS MADE BY COMMISSIONER DON BOWEN, SECONDED BY
COMMISSIONER KATHY LUPPY TO APPROVE THE REQUEST SUBJECT TO IT
BEING LOCATED 10 FEET FROM THE NORTH AND 30 FEET FROM THE WEST
AND A 4-FOOT WAINSCOATING ON ALL SIDES OF THE STRUCTURE.
MOTION TO APPROVE CARRIED 6-0.
